They don't even understand their own pet theory.
The idea of human caused global warming is that use of fossil fuels is increasing the net carbon in the cycle, because carbon that was trapped far below the earth's surface is being released when oil or coal is burned.
Animals and plants, which are all carbon-based life forms, do not cause a net increase in atmospheric carbon since they are already part of the existing carbon cycle. The methane produced by a cow comes from it digesting plant matter. Those same chemical processes would have occurred whether the plants were digested or rotted in the round after the plants died. It is not a net increase in carbon. This whole problem that leftists claim to have with meat and cattle is a concocted issue. What the really want is power and control.
